RED POPPIES
synopsis
We see the story of the battle through the eyes of Jedrek - a young boy who went through the hell of the gulag and left Russia with the Anders Army as one of thousands of orphans. The time of captivity changed him from a boy from a good family into a schemer and petty thief who will do anything to survive. However, meeting the soldiers of the II Corps and the awakening love for the nurse Pola will make Jedrek undergo a profound transformation. Soon, a decisive attack on the monastery, defended by German troops, located on the hills of Monte Cassino is about to take place at the front - this spectacular battle will decide about the lives of many soldiers and the further attack of the allied army in Italy, and will change Jedrek's life forever.
| international title: | Red Poppies |
| original title: | Czerwone maki |
| country: | Poland |
| year: | 2024 |
| genre: | fiction |
| directed by: | Krzysztof Łukaszewicz |
| film run: | 122' |
| release date: | PL 5/04/2024 |
| screenplay: | Krzysztof Łukaszewicz |
| cast: | Nicolas Przygoda, Leszek Lichota, Mateusz Banasiuk, Bartlomiej Topa, Magdalena Zyzak, David L. Price, Filip Gurlacz, Michał Zurawski, Cezary Łukaszewicz, Darren J. Bransford |
| cinematography by: | Arkadiusz Tomiak |
| art director: | Marek Warszewski |
| costumes designer: | Agnieszka Sobiecka |
| producer: | Zbigniew Domagalski |
| line producer: | Ivan Petrusic |
| production: | WFDiF - Wytwórnia Filmów Dokumentalnych i Fabularnych |
| distributor: | Kino Świat |
